Searching for the perfect Syrah pairing? Look no further! Enjoy our medium bodied Syrah with a tasty keto-friendly Spinach Artichoke Pizza with Cauliflower Crust.

Prep Time: 5 minutes

Cook Time: 20 minutes

Recipe ByThe Southern Source and Well and Worthy Life

Ingredients:

  • 1 Trader Joes Cauliflower Pizza Crust
  • 1/4 cup of shallots minced
  • 3 cloves fresh garlic minced
  • 8oz half and half cream 
  • 1 bag fresh spinach or about 5 cups raw spinach
  • 1/2 cup marinated artichokes 
  • Handful of grape tomatoes halved
  • 1/2 cup crumbled feta cheese

Instructions

  1. Sauté raw spinach over medium heat.
  2. Cook spinach for about 3-4 minutes until wilted. Transfer over to sink and let cool in a colander.
  3. While spinach cools, add 1-2 tablespoons of olive oil to the pan you used for the spinach. Add in shallot and cook for 2-3 minutes. Salt and Pepper. 
  4. Add minced garlic to the shallots and stir together. 
  5. Add cream to the pan and bring to a simmer. You'll want to leave the cream at a simmer over medium heat (making sure not to burn) for about 10-12 minutes or until it starts to thicken.
  6. While sauce continues to cook, go back to sink and remove as much water from the spinach as possible.
  7. Combine spinach and artichokes on a cutting board and roughly chop. Add spinach and artichokes into sauce
  8. Start assembling pizza by spooning white sauce onto pre-made pizza crust. Add tomatoes and top with cheese. Bake in the oven for 7-9 minutes or desired time on your pizza crusts' packaging.
